Runbook: Scanline barcode bridge

If warehouse scans stop flowing into Cartwheel, it's almost always the bridge service on the Dunmore floor box wedging after a USB hiccup. Bounce the service first — nine times out of ten that fixes it. If not, check the queue depth before escalating. When restarting, make sure the bridge comes up with these settings.

deployment values, yafop-bajef:
[gilok]
team = ulaius
access_code = ac_423664
host = gilok.sivrelhq.corp
port = 9200
owner = pelius.istax
peer = eliok.torvasoft.internal

### Step 4: Apply relevance tuning defaults

After reindexing, the Bramblewick search cluster needs the new relevance profile loaded before traffic resumes. The old per-field boost file is deprecated; values now live in the central tuning service. Apply the profile on each query node, then validate with the golden-query suite. Set the nodes to the following configuration values.

deployment values, bahof-badug:
[rusix]
team = zorok
access_code = ac_641cbe
owner = ulair.tamius
host = rusix.torvasoft.local
port = 5672
peer = ulaix.sivrelworks.internal
salt = 1df570ed
pin = 6327

The Pebblecache tier sits behind a bloom filter that short-circuits lookups for keys that definitely aren't in the Vaultine store. If the filter's false-positive rate climbs above 2%, trigger a rebuild via the admin endpoint — it takes about ten minutes and is safe during business hours. The rebuild call authenticates against the internal Vaultine admin service using the key below.

gateway credential: kto3_qfe